Structure

Tasks entrusted to the Reserve and subordinate zakazniks are implemented by the following departments:

 

  • Protection Department of the Reserved Territory
  • Protection Department of Federal Zakazniks
  • Scientific Department
  • Department of Ecological Education
  • Department for Maintenance of Basic Activities
  • Accounting and Reporting Department
  • Personnel and Legal Departmen

 

Protection Department of the Reserved Territory

The main objective of the Department is the enforcement of a special protection regime in the Reserve sections and buffer zones.

The Department includes state inspectors, senior state inspectors of two protected sections and the Head of Department - Deputy Director on the Protection of the Reserved Territory.

To support the work of the Department and control of execution of tasks assigned to the personnel, it is created the Task Force on the Protection of the Reserved Territory which reports directly to the Director of the Reserve.

Protection Department of Federal Zakazniks

The main objective of the Department is the enforcement of a special protection regime in three federal zakazniks, situated on the territory of the Republic of Dagestan - Agrakhanski, Samurski and Tlyaratinski.

The Department includes state inspectors, senior state inspectors of two protected sections and the Head of Department - Deputy Director on the Protection of Federal Zakazniks.

To support the work of the Department and control of execution of tasks assigned to the personnel, it is created the Task Force on the Protection of the Federal Zakazniks, which reports directly to the Director of the Reserve.

 Scientific Department

Key tasks of the Scientific Department are regular monitoring of the condition of protected natural territories and objects, study of processes and phenomena in ecosystems, records in ‘the Chronicles of Nature’ and publication of the Transactions of the Reserve.

The Department includes laboratory assistants, scientists, and the Head of the Department - Deputy Director on Scientific Work.

Department of Ecological Education

Ecological education is one of the most important activities of the Reserve. The Department includes guides, methodologists, and the Head of the Department - Deputy Director on Ecological Education.

The main objectives of the Department is ecological awareness of all groups of people, distribution of knowledge about the Reserve, its natural heritage and nature conservation activities, organization of educational and promotional actions and campaigns.

 

Department for Maintenance of Basic Activities

The basic activities of the reserve are ensured by executive personnel, masters, drivers and administrative staff, directed by the Head of the Department. The main task of the Department is a full logistical support of all structural units of the Reserve.

Accounting and Reporting Department

The financial and economic activities and reporting of the Reserve is provided by the staff of this Department, headed by the Chief Accountant of the Reserve.

Personnel and Legal Department

The main objectives of the Department are work with personnel and legal support of all departments of the Reserve.
